Suggestive painterly style image generation system to satisfy user preferences
In non-photorealistic rendering (NPR), an evaluated value of the rendered image is not absolute. It is different for each user. Therefore, in NPR, it is important to render an image that satisfies user preferences. Many methods of painterly style image generation have been proposed/developed. However, these methods focus on image generation that imitates painting material or a painterly style. Therefore, to the best of our knowledge, the study of how to generate a painterly style image that satisfies user preferences dose not yet exist. When gazing at an image, the user is more effective at quickly identifying regions that the user dislikes than in finding preferred regions. To address this point, we propose a mechanism of painterly style rendering that satisfies user preferences.
